21xrx.com
2024-09-19 09:28:41 Thursday
登录
文章检索 我的文章 写文章
C++基础知识概览
2023-06-30 18:30:33 深夜i     --     --
C++ 基础知识 语法 编程 变量

C++是一种高级的、面向对象的编程语言,在计算机科学领域得到广泛的应用。C++的优点是它的高效性和代码可重用性,因此它被广泛用于编写包括游戏、桌面应用程序、系统软件等在内的各种应用程序。在学习C++前,我们需要了解一些基本概念和语法。

首先,C++是一种强类型语言,这意味着在编写代码时需声明变量的数据类型。例如,int型表示整数,float型表示浮点数,char型表示字符等等。在C++中,声明变量的语法是:

数据类型 变量名;

例如,声明一个整数变量的语句是:

int num;

接下来是C++的基本运算符。运算符是用来操作数据的符号。加号、减号、乘号、除号和求余号是C++的基本运算符。例如,一个加法运算符 + 可以用来将两个数字相加,例如:

int a = 5;

int b = 3;

int c = a + b; // 运算结果是 8

在C++中还有一些其他的运算符,如自增、自减、逻辑运算符、位运算符等等。我们需要熟悉这些运算符的语法和用法。

函数也是C++中很重要的一个概念。函数使代码可重用化,避免了代码的重复编写。函数可以是内部或外部。内部函数是定义在主函数内部的函数,外部函数则是定义在主函数外部的函数。例如:

// 内部函数

int add(int x, int y)

{

  int sum = x + y;

  return sum;

}

// 外部函数

#include

using namespace std;

int main()

{

  int a = 5;

  int b = 3;

  int result = add(a, b);

  cout << result << endl;

}

以上是定义一个简单的函数并在主函数中调用它的例子。我们需要知道如何定义函数、调用函数以及函数的返回值类型等等。

最后一个重要的概念是面向对象编程。C++是一种面向对象的语言,这意味着我们可以将代码组织成类和对象,以便更好地组织和管理代码。类是一个代码模板,它定义了一些变量和函数,以及它们的作用范围。对象是类的实例,我们可以使用它来调用类中定义的函数或访问类中定义的变量。例如:

class Person {

 public:

  string name;

  int age;

  void say_hello()

    cout << "Hello

};

int main() {

  Person john;

  john.name = "John";

  john.age = 21;

  john.say_hello();

  return 0;

}

以上是定义一个名为 Person 的类和在 main 函数中创建一个对象 john 并使用该对象来调用 say_hello 函数的例子。我们需要学习如何定义类和对象、如何访问类中的变量和函数等等。

以上是C++基础知识的概览。要成为一名优秀的C++开发人员,您需要深入研究这些概念并掌握它们的用法。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复